XFC-59-100 Equivalent & Substitute Parts Reference
Part Overview
The XFC-59-100 is an F Type Connector Plug with male pin configuration, designed for free hanging (in-line) installation in RG-59 cable applications. Manufactured by Greenlee Communications, this connector features compression shield termination and threaded fastening, with weatherproof ingress protection and silver housing.
The XFC-59-100 is classified as obsolete. Identifying equivalent substitute parts is necessary to maintain system compatibility, ensure continued availability for maintenance and repair operations, and support procurement for legacy installations where this connector type remains in service.

Substitute Part Grouping Explanation
Substitution eligibility for the XFC-59-100 is determined by strict alignment with the following core parameters:
Mandatory Matching Parameters:
- Connector Style: F Type
- Connector Type: Plug, Male Pin
- Mounting Type: Free Hanging (In-Line)
- Cable Group: RG-59
- Fastening Type: Threaded
- Number of Ports: 1
Compatibility Considerations: The substitute part 414766-8 (TE Connectivity AMP Connectors) satisfies all mandatory matching parameters. This part maintains functional and mechanical compatibility with the XFC-59-100 in RG-59 cable applications. The substitute introduces additional specified parameters (75 Ohm impedance, operating temperature range, voltage rating) that were not defined in the original part specification, representing enhanced technical documentation rather than functional deviation.

Engineering Selection Recommendations
Primary Substitute: 414766-8 (TE Connectivity AMP Connectors)
The 414766-8 is the designated manufacturer-recommended substitute for the XFC-59-100. This part maintains all critical mechanical and functional parameters required for RG-59 cable applications with F Type threaded connectors.
Compliance and Availability: The 414766-8 holds Active product status with current inventory availability (1065 pcs), ensuring reliable procurement for ongoing maintenance and new installations. The part is ROHS3 compliant, meeting current environmental and regulatory requirements. The XFC-59-100, classified as Obsolete, presents supply chain risk for future procurement.
Technical Alignment: Both connectors are specified for RG-59 cable group with identical mounting configuration (free hanging, in-line) and fastening method (threaded). The substitute provides explicit electrical specifications (75 Ohm impedance, 500 V voltage rating, -65°C to 85°C operating range) that establish performance parameters suitable for standard RF coaxial applications.
Shield Termination Difference: The XFC-59-100 specifies compression shield termination, while the 414766-8 uses crimp termination. Both methods provide effective electromagnetic shielding in F Type connector applications. Crimp termination is the industry standard for modern F Type connectors and is compatible with standard RG-59 cable preparation procedures.
Frequently Asked Questions (FAQ)
Q: Can the 414766-8 directly replace the XFC-59-100 in existing installations?
A: Yes. Both connectors share identical connector style (F Type), type (Plug, Male Pin), mounting configuration (free hanging, in-line), cable group (RG-59), and fastening method (threaded). These parameters determine mechanical and functional compatibility. The 414766-8 is the manufacturer-recommended substitute.
Q: What is the difference between compression and crimp shield termination?
A: Compression termination uses a ferrule that compresses around the cable shield when tightened. Crimp termination uses a ferrule that is mechanically deformed onto the cable shield. Both methods provide effective shielding. The 414766-8 crimp design is standard for modern F Type connectors and is compatible with RG-59 cable.
Q: Why does the 414766-8 specify 75 Ohm impedance when the XFC-59-100 does not?
A: The XFC-59-100 specification does not include impedance documentation. The 414766-8 explicitly specifies 75 Ohm impedance, which is the standard impedance for F Type connectors in video and broadband RF applications. This represents enhanced technical documentation rather than a functional difference.
Q: Is the 414766-8 suitable for the same operating environment as the XFC-59-100?
A: The XFC-59-100 specifies weatherproof ingress protection. The 414766-8 does not document ingress protection rating. Both connectors are F Type designs with silver housing suitable for standard RF cable applications. For applications requiring specific environmental protection ratings, verify ingress protection requirements against application specifications.
